+/*
+** Global Declarations
+**
+** Virtually all non-local variable declarations are made in this
+** file. Exceptions are those things which are initialized, which
+** are defined in "externs.c", and things which are local to one
+** program file.
+**
+** So far as I know, nothing in here must be preinitialized to
+** zero.
+**
+** You may have problems from the loader if you move this to a
+** different machine. These things actually get allocated in each
+** source file, which UNIX allows; however, you may (on other
+** systems) have to change everything in here to be "extern" and
+** actually allocate stuff in "externs.c"
+*/

+/********************* GALAXY **************************/
+
+/* galactic parameters */
+# define NSECTS 10 /* dimensions of quadrant in sectors */
+# define NQUADS 8 /* dimension of galazy in quadrants */
+# define NINHAB 32 /* number of quadrants which are inhabited */
+
+struct quad /* definition for each quadrant */
+{
+ char bases; /* number of bases in this quadrant */
+ char klings; /* number of Klingons in this quadrant */
+ char holes; /* number of black holes in this quadrant */
+ int scanned; /* star chart entry (see below) */
+ char stars; /* number of stars in this quadrant */
+ char qsystemname; /* starsystem name (see below) */
+};
+
+# define Q_DISTRESSED 0200
+# define Q_SYSTEM 077
+
+/* systemname conventions:
+ * 1 -> NINHAB index into Systemname table for live system.
+ * + Q_DISTRESSED distressed starsystem -- systemname & Q_SYSTEM
+ * is the index into the Event table which will
+ * have the system name
+ * 0 dead or nonexistent starsystem
+ *
+ * starchart ("scanned") conventions:
+ * 0 -> 999 taken as is
+ * -1 not yet scanned ("...")
+ * 1000 supernova ("///")
+ * 1001 starbase + ??? (".1.")
+*/
+
+/* ascii names of systems */
+extern char *Systemname[NINHAB];
+
+/* quadrant definition */
+struct quad Quad[NQUADS][NQUADS];
+
+/* defines for sector map (below) */
+# define EMPTY '.'
+# define STAR '*'
+# define BASE '#'
+# define ENTERPRISE 'E'
+# define QUEENE 'Q'
+# define KLINGON 'K'
+# define INHABIT '@'
+# define HOLE ' '
+
+/* current sector map */
+char Sect[NSECTS][NSECTS];
+
+
+/************************ DEVICES ******************************/
+
+# define NDEV 16 /* max number of devices */
+
+/* device tokens */
+# define WARP 0 /* warp engines */
+# define SRSCAN 1 /* short range scanners */
+# define LRSCAN 2 /* long range scanners */
+# define PHASER 3 /* phaser control */
+# define TORPED 4 /* photon torpedo control */
+# define IMPULSE 5 /* impulse engines */
+# define SHIELD 6 /* shield control */
+# define COMPUTER 7 /* on board computer */
+# define SSRADIO 8 /* subspace radio */
+# define LIFESUP 9 /* life support systems */
+# define SINS 10 /* Space Inertial Navigation System */
+# define CLOAK 11 /* cloaking device */
+# define XPORTER 12 /* transporter */
+# define SHUTTLE 13 /* shuttlecraft */
+
+/* device names */
+struct device
+{
+ char *name; /* device name */
+ char *person; /* the person who fixes it */
+};
+
+struct device Device[NDEV];
+
+/*************************** EVENTS ****************************/
+
+# define NEVENTS 12 /* number of different event types */
+
+# define E_LRTB 1 /* long range tractor beam */
+# define E_KATSB 2 /* Klingon attacks starbase */
+# define E_KDESB 3 /* Klingon destroys starbase */
+# define E_ISSUE 4 /* distress call is issued */
+# define E_ENSLV 5 /* Klingons enslave a quadrant */
+# define E_REPRO 6 /* a Klingon is reproduced */
+# define E_FIXDV 7 /* fix a device */
+# define E_ATTACK 8 /* Klingon attack during rest period */
+# define E_SNAP 9 /* take a snapshot for time warp */
+# define E_SNOVA 10 /* supernova occurs */
+
+# define E_GHOST 0100 /* ghost of a distress call if ssradio out */
+# define E_HIDDEN 0200 /* event that is unreportable because ssradio out */
+# define E_EVENT 077 /* mask to get event code */
+
+struct event
+{
+ char x, y; /* coordinates */
+ double date; /* trap stardate */
+ char evcode; /* event type */
+ char systemname; /* starsystem name */
+};
+/* systemname conventions:
+ * 1 -> NINHAB index into Systemname table for reported distress calls
+ *
+ * evcode conventions:
+ * 1 -> NEVENTS-1 event type
+ * + E_HIDDEN unreported (SSradio out)
+ * + E_GHOST actually already expired
+ * 0 unallocated
+ */
+
+# define MAXEVENTS 25 /* max number of concurrently pending events */
+
+struct event Event[MAXEVENTS]; /* dynamic event list; one entry per pending event */
